Course Content

• Understanding Body Dysmorphic Disorder (BDD): Symptoms, Diagnosis, and Comorbidities
•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) for BDD: Techniques and Applications
• Challenging Body Image Distortions: Cognitive Restructuring and Exposure Therapy
• The Role of Perfectionism and Self-Esteem in BDD
• Understanding and Addressing Emotional Regulation in BDD
• The Impact of Social Media and Cultural Influences on Body Image and BDD
• Working with Relapse Prevention Strategies in BDD
• Developing Self-Compassion and Acceptance in Recovery from BDD
• Case Studies in Body Dysmorphic Disorder Treatment
• Ethical Considerations and Best Practices in BDD Therapy

Career path

Career Role Description
Cognitive Behavioural Therapist (CBT) specializing in BDD Highly sought-after professionals delivering evidence-based therapies for Body Dysmorphic Disorder, utilizing Cognitive Restructuring techniques. Strong demand in NHS and private practice.
Clinical Psychologist specializing in BDD and Cognitive Distortions Diagnose and treat individuals with Body Dysmorphic Disorder using various therapeutic approaches,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T). High earning potential.
Counselor specializing in Body Image and Self-Esteem Provides support and guidance to individuals struggling with body image issues and negative self-perception, often working alongside other mental health professionals. Growing demand across diverse settings.
Mental Health Nurse specializing in BDD Plays a crucial role in providing holistic care to individuals with Body Dysmorphic Disorder, coll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to deliver comprehensive treatment plans.
